The Isolation and Characterization of a Hitherto Undescribed Gram-Negative Bacterium

A unique undosciribed gramnegative rod is extensively characterized in this study. The cells of this unusual water isolate measure 1.2 X 6.5 microns, The most distinguishing characteristic of the bacterium is a polar tuft of 35-40 flagella that aggregate to function as a single organelle which is visible under phase contrast. Aging cells deposit poly- -hydroxybutyric acid granules which are bound by an inclusion membrane made up of four distinct layers. It also possesses an unusual exterior membrane outside the cell wall which contains large fibrils of protein running at a slight angle to the longitudinal axis of the cell. The guanosine-cytosine ratio was found to be 62.2$. The organism's taxonomic position was further investigated by immunological, morphological, and biochemical methods. It was found to be most closely akin to members of the genus Pseudo onas, although somewhat divergent from other species classified in this genus. After careful evaluation of the findings obtained during this study, the new bacterium was subsequently named Pseudomonas multiflagella.

In Vivo and In Vitro Transformations of Mouse Tissues from a Murine Lymphosarcoma

The problem with which this investigation is concerned is that of determining the nature of events leading to the change. of normal cells into malignant cells. The design of the study is multi-phasic: (A) to establish the presence or absence of an oncogenic virion, (B) to demonstrate by use of the electron microscopy any ultracellular alteration in malignant or transformed tissues, (C) to investigate the nature of the transforming agent in the murine lymphosarcoma, and (D) to employ various methods to demonstrate cellular transformations in vivo and in vitro. It is concluded that the transforming and tumorinducing agent in this' investigation was not a virion, but an infectious ribonucleic acid genome or a segment of a viral genome which had become integrated into the genome of the mouse cells. The vision has lost its ability to form a protein coat; therefore it is not demonstrable as a virion. But the ribonucleic acid is able to infect other cells and transform them from normal to neoplastic tissues.

The Stoneflies (Plecoptera) of Oklahoma

Distributional data and taxonomic keys art presented for thirty-four species of Plecoptera known to occur in Oklahoma. Ten species are new records for the state. Descriptions are provided for two species new to science, Zealeuctra cherokee and Isoperla brevis, and for the previously unknown male of Strophopteryx cucullata Frison and female of Helopicus nalatus (Frison).

A Carcinogenic Agent Elaborated by Liver Cells from Lymphosarcoma-Bearing Mice

Liver cells from lymphosarcoma-bearing DBA/1J mice were shown, by parabiotic culture with normal liver cells from isologous mice, to elaborate an agent which could pass a 25 mu filter and transform the normal cells to a malignant state.
